html + css +tabelle
peter schneider
- css
0 Steel0 steckl0 Gunnar Bittersmann
hallo zusammen,
an diesem problem beisse ich mir noch die zähne aus, also ich müsste eine tabelle haben, bei welchem NUR die horizontalen linien gepunktet sind (=dotted). ich versuchte es extern mit css zu definieren und dann mit style=css reinzuladen, ging aber nicht. wie programmiert man am einfachsten eine solche tabelle?
gruss
peter
Hi!
Da Du uns deine Versuche vorenthaelst, kann ich Dir nur sagen, was Du eigentlich schon wissen solltest.
In der HTML Datei mit der Tabelle das exterene Stylesheet einbinden (http://de.selfhtml.org/css/formate/einbinden.htm#separat)und den Zellen im CSS per border den Rand am unteren Teil verpassen (http://de.selfhtml.org/css/eigenschaften/rahmen.htm).
Wie du den Zellen jetzt das CSS zuordnest, ueberlasse ich Dir. Anbieten wuerde sich eine Tabelle mit ID ueber die man dann die Zellen anspricht.
Kleine Anmerkung am Rand: Man programmiert so eine Tabelle nicht. Jedenfalls nicht mit HTML und CSS. Dazu muessten es Programmiersprachen sein. Nenn es meinetwegen coden oder einfach erstellen.
Bei mir wuerde es so aussehen (alternativ ohne ID):
#TabellenID td
{
border-bottom: 1px dotted #ffffff;
}
Hi,
an diesem problem beisse ich mir noch die zähne aus, also ich müsste eine tabelle haben, bei welchem NUR die horizontalen linien gepunktet sind (=dotted).
wie programmiert man am einfachsten eine solche tabelle?
Verwende beispielsweise folgendes CSS (getestet im FF2):
table {
border-collapse:collapse;
}
table td {
padding: 0;
margin: 0;
border-bottom: 5px dotted black;
border-top: 5px dotted black;
}
ich versuchte es extern mit css zu definieren und dann mit style=css reinzuladen, ging aber nicht.
Kapier ich nicht.
mfG,
steckl
Hello out there!
hallo zusammen,
an diesem problem beisse ich mir noch die zähne aus, also ich müsste eine tabelle haben, bei welchem NUR die horizontalen linien gepunktet sind (=dotted).
Dann wäre ein oberer oder unterer Rahmen [CSS2 §8.5; http://de.selfhtml.org/css/eigenschaften/rahmen.htm@title=SELFHTML] für die Tabellen_zeilen_ zu setzen, also für 'tr', nicht für 'td'.
Damit die 'border'-Eigenschaft für 'tr' Wirkung zeigt, muss das entsprechende Rahmenmodell mit zusammenfallenden Rahmen [CSS2 §17.6] gewählt werden.
Mit den Pseudoklassen ':first-child' [CSS2 §5.11.1; http://de.selfhtml.org/css/eigenschaften/pseudoformate.htm@title=SELFHTML] bzw. ':last-child' [CSS3] kann der Rahmen für die erste bzw. letzte Zeile entfernt werden.
See ya up the road,
Gunnar